2022 IP and the Internet

The California Lawyers Association IP Section is hosting its flagship program, IP and the Internet, on July 27 at 9:00 am CST. The virtual conference will cover a wide range of internet law topics, from new issues like Non-fungible Tokens (NFTs), to evergreen and constantly evolving issues like privacy, cybersecurity and website legal compliance. Greenberg Traurig Shareholder Ian C. Ballon, Co-Chair of the firm's Global Intellectual Property & Technology Practice, will lead the session "Internet Law Year in Review: Hindsight is 2022." The session will focus on the past year of changes in internet law and how quickly those laws can impact the internet.
